    Drip Filter Coffee Machine

    Drip filter coffee machine is a coffee brewing method that involves pouring hot water over the ground coffee, and let it drip through a paper or metal filter into the carafe below. This method is based on an element of heating, showerhead and the filter compartment.

    The heating element is usually an aluminum tube that is activated as electricity passes through it.

    The water reservoir

    A drip filter coffee filter machine maker does a lot of clever work to transform the cup of ground beans and water into a hot cup of coffee. The water reservoir the filter basket, the carafe, and showerhead all have specific functions that ensure optimal extraction of the flavors and oils from the ground.

    The water reservoir is an enormous bucket that stores the water used to brew. It's usually made of plastic or glass and is an essential component in the brewing process. The reservoir is put on top of the base plate to the pot. It is usually heated to prevent the water from cooling too fast.

    Water is drawn from the reservoir through an orange tube and then transferred to the heating element, which is heated by the water and the plate that the pot is placed on. The water is heated and then pumped up through an insulated tube to the faucet, where it is sprayed onto the coffee grounds. The water is sprayed over the coffee grounds, which causes the hot liquid to drop through the filter before it is poured into the carafe.

    The filter basket

    A drip filter coffee machine is the filter basket which is stocked with ground coffee. The filter basket drips hot water into the small openings in the bottom, as it moves through the grounds of the coffee. These openings are usually covered with small pieces of paper or metal. The basket is equipped with showerheads that evenly distribute hot water evenly across the grounds. This ensures the consistent extraction of oils and flavors in all parts of the beans. The shape and size of the basket can have a significant impact on the quality of the brewed coffee.

    Cone filters, for instance, tend to have a tapered shape that concentrates the flow of water across the grounds. This can lead to an enhanced flavor profile and a longer period of extraction. Basket filters however, have a flat bottom which allows the water to disperse more evenly. This may result in a milder taste, but also reduce the possibility that you'll overor underestimate the amount of extraction.

    It's mostly an issue of personal preference whether you select either a cone or basket filter. Some coffee drinkers prefer the full-flavored flavor that cone filters offer however others prefer the basket filter's more subtle flavor profile.     The heating element

    The heating element is a crucial component in any drip filter coffee maker. It's responsible for two functions heating the water to the optimal temperature for brewing, and ensuring that the coffee remains warm once it's made. It does this by using the heat plate under the carafe, and an aluminum tube to carry the water. The heating element is a metal piece that emits heat when electricity flows through. This causes the water to heat up when it travels through the tube.

    Once the water has been heated, it will begin to bubble. This helps to push the water upwards and out of tubing, into the filter holder that holds the coffee grounds. The water begins to drip down into the coffee grounds and extract flavor from them. The water drips in patterns to ensure that the grounds are completely saturated.

    The one-way valve can be found in the water tank or in the tube that transports it, and it stops the hot water from escaping back into the cold reservoir of water. This is important since it can make your coffee taste bad and waste electricity.

    The majority of drip coffee machines use a system that uses switches and timers to regulate the flow of water and how long the water can remain in the grounds. The machine will also know when the coffee has finished making and shut off its heating plates automatically. This is helpful since it can prevent over-extracted or burnt coffee.
